General Info
In Block
19f8993eaab09cc5fe186b6c169cc571e534f4977144f8275160831a775710fb
In block height
Total Input
625.57306454 RDD
Total Output
624.57306454 RDD
Transaction Details
Fee
1 RDD
mined Sun, 14 Jan 2018 08:00:36 UTC
From
19.998 RDDFrom
49.9659395 RDDFrom
56.80449228 RDDFrom
498.80463276 RDD